Hi George, A few years back I bought an ex factory used Mitsubishi PHEV from a dealer.
 I get between 40 to 50Kms off each home charge.
 Enough for about 2 to 3 days shopping around here.
 

 It takes 12KW or maybe a little more to recharge the Lithium Ion batt from standard 240V 10A power point.
 About 5 hours. (At 25 cents per KWH it's less than $5).
 

 I use 18 on roof solar panels on house to recharge it during sunny days. 
 Last week we reached a new high of 43 KWH in one day from the panels.

 Sometimes only about 10KWH or less if overcast.
 

 Haven't purchased gasoline for approx last 3 months, about every 6 months the system in the car forces me to put half a tank of fuel through it to keep things lubricated.
 

 I put a mod chip in the car to keep petrol motor from starting when in "eco" mode is selected.
 Chip cuts out under sudden acceleration allowing petrol motor to kick in again.
 

 Hate to think what a replacement Li battery might cost, maybe over $10K here?
 

 Anyhow I really like the silence and absolute smoothness of the electric propulsion.
 Plus I sometimes tow a trailer with it.... not many hybrids can do this.
 

 I don't have ability knowledge or skill to build an EV but I admire those who do.
 

 Gerry
Hi Gerry,
That's exactly the sort of thing I have been  looking for, but a little further than 50 km would be good.

I've got a great solar system of 96 panels giving me 24 kw over 3 phase at 8 kw per phase and even in the rain I can get 7 or 8 kw and the same on a dull day, so I won't have any trouble charging a car like that.
Because I haven't been able to find an EV for sale I started toying with the idea of building one.
I want one that can go at least 60 to 80 km if possible.
My nearest town to Canowindra is Cowra, 30 km away.
George
